The ingredients needed to make Gyoza Chinese Dumplings:
- Prepare 200 g minced pork
- Prepare 400 g cut vegetables (cabbage, leek,Chinese cabbage, any vegetables)
- Take 3 tablespoon sesame oil
- Take 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- Make ready 1/2-1 tablespoon chicken bouillon powder
- Make ready 1 tablespoon grind ginger
- Prepare 1 teaspoon grind garlic
- Take Black pepper
- Take 48 Dumplings sheets (2 packs)

Instructions to make Gyoza Chinese Dumplings:
- Cut vegetables finely
- Mix all the seasoning with hand
- Put some on dumpling skin
- Fold
- Put Gyoza on sesame oil pan
- Bake till the bottom side is lightly brown, then put boiled water.
- Cook till the water is thikened
- Pour the sesame oil
- Bake till the bottom is crispy and good brown
- Dish
